INTRODUCTION "There are short-cuts to Happiness and Dancing is one of them" Vicki Baum "The Job of feet is walking but their hobby is dancing" Amit Kalantri Dance has been a part of the human lives since ages. We perform dance for various purposes. We dance to celebrate, we dance to perform rituals, we dance to involve in recreational activities, we dance for fun, we dance for pursuing our hobby, we dance for artistic expression, we dance for getting physically fit, we dance to expression emotions, we dance to communicate and we dance to keep ourselves physical and mentally healthy. The sense of rhythm beats and dance is so effective that even babies respond to the tempo more than they do to the speech. It means human beings are born with the ability to move our body in response to the music When we study the positive effects of dance on our health, some of the obvious and much discussed benefits include body flexibility, muscular strength, physical fitness, body balance and posture etc. Dance has also found to be effective in improving cognitions and memory, decreasing the risk of dementia. It also helps in overcoming depressive symptoms, dizziness, fatigue and procrastination. Dance has been found to be effective in creating new neural pathways due to which the information stored in the brain can be accessed with ease. It also results in more secretions of feel good neurotransmitters in our body. Dance is also an intensive activity for our brain through which various activities related to different senses are combined. The individual involves auditory, visual and tactile sensations along with the body balance, rhythm, coordination and movement.
